在制造业中,数控车床作为一种高精度、高效率的加工设备,已经成为现代制造业的核心。而数控车顶尖编程作为数控车床操作的核心技能,对于实现工件的高效加工至关重要。本文将深入探讨数控车顶尖编程的技巧和策略,帮助您轻松掌握这一技能。
数控车顶尖编程基础
1. 数控车床简介
数控车床是一种通过计算机程序控制的车床,能够实现复杂工件的加工。它具有加工精度高、生产效率高、自动化程度高等特点。
2. 数控车顶尖编程的基本概念
数控车顶尖编程是指利用计算机编程语言编写控制数控车床进行加工的程序。这些程序包括刀具路径、加工参数、切削参数等。
数控车顶尖编程技巧
1. 熟练掌握编程语言
数控车顶尖编程通常使用G代码、M代码等编程语言。熟练掌握这些编程语言是进行高效编程的基础。
2. 合理规划刀具路径
刀具路径是数控车顶尖编程的核心。合理的刀具路径可以减少加工时间,提高加工效率。
3. 优化加工参数
加工参数包括切削速度、进给量、切削深度等。优化这些参数可以降低加工成本,提高加工质量。
4. 利用CAM软件辅助编程
CAM(计算机辅助制造)软件可以帮助用户快速生成刀具路径,减少编程工作量。
数控车顶尖编程实例
以下是一个简单的数控车顶尖编程实例:
O1000
G21
G90
G0 X0 Y0 Z0
G43 H1 Z1.0
G96 S500 M3
G0 X50
G1 Z-30 F100
G0 Z0
G0 X0
G0 Z0
G0 X50
G1 Z-30 F100
G0 Z0
G0 X0
G0 Z0
G0 X0 Y0
G28 G91 Z0
G28 G91 X0
M30
这段代码实现了对一个圆柱体的粗车和精车加工。其中,G21表示使用毫米单位,G90表示绝对定位,G0表示快速移动,G1表示线性插补,G96表示恒定切削速度,M3表示主轴正转。
总结
掌握数控车顶尖编程对于实现工件高效加工至关重要。通过熟练掌握编程语言、合理规划刀具路径、优化加工参数以及利用CAM软件辅助编程,您可以轻松实现工件的高效加工。希望本文能对您有所帮助。
